Home » Restaurants » America » Santa Ana Restaurants » La Chiquita Restaurant | 906 E Washington Ave Santa Ana CA 92701 United States

La Chiquita Restaurant | 906 E Washington Ave Santa Ana CA 92701 United States Restaurant Menu & Phone

Restaurant Reviews:

/5

La Chiquita Restaurant | 906 E Washington Ave Santa Ana CA 92701 United States Contact Details

906 E Washington Ave Santa Ana CA 92701 United States

Related Restaurants